由於double類型的數據精度問題,所以它的比較往往存在誤差。 JavaAPI自帶的方法可以比較double類型的數據 API方法的聲明如下: public static int compare (double d1,double d2); d1是第一個要比較的數,d2是第二個要比較的數 ...
一.Java基本類型共有八種,基本類型可以分為三類,字符類型char,布爾類型boolean以及數值類型byte short int long float double。數值類型又可以分為整數類型byte short int long和浮點數類型float double。JAVA中的數值類型不存在無符號的,它們的取值范圍是固定的,不會隨着機器硬件環境或者操作系統的改變而改變 基本類型 大小 字節 ...
2020-07-09 21:00 0 1372 推薦指數:
由於double類型的數據精度問題,所以它的比較往往存在誤差。 JavaAPI自帶的方法可以比較double類型的數據 API方法的聲明如下: public static int compare (double d1,double d2); d1是第一個要比較的數,d2是第二個要比較的數 ...
一、基本數據類型 Java語言提供了八種基本類型。六種數值類型(四個整數型,兩個浮點型),一種字符類型,還有一種布爾型。 java中基本數據類型中沒有無符號類型(C、C++中有),只有有符號類型。 在計算機內,定點數有3種表示法:原碼、反碼和補碼 原碼 :二進制 ...
方法一:轉成字符串之后比較 如果要比較的兩個double數據的字符串精度相等,可以將數據轉換成string然后借助string的equals方法來間接實現比較兩個double數據是否相等。注意這種方法只適用於比較精度相同的數據,並且是只用用於比較是否相等的情況下,不能用來判斷大小 ...
java 日期Date類型比較大小 CreateTime--2018年5月31日16點39分 Author:Marydon 通過Date.getTime()方法來比較實現大小的比對 /** * 判斷日期是否在指定范圍內 ...
這個類是java里精確計算的類 1、比較對象是否相等,一般的對象用equals,但是BigDecimal比較特殊,舉個例子 BigDecimal a = new BigDecimal.valueOf(1.0); BigDecimal b = new BigDecimal.valueOf ...
Java的基本數據類型 變量就是申請內存來存儲值。也就是說,當創建變量的時候,需要在內存中申請空間。 內存管理系統根據變量的類型為變量分配存儲空間,分配的空間只能用來儲存該類型數據 ...
http://blog.csdn.net/rabbit_in_android/article/details/49793813 基本類型 大小(字節) 默認值 封裝類 byte 1 (byte ...
一、Java基本數據類型 基本數據類型有8種:byte、short、int、long、float、double、boolean、char 分為4類:整數型、浮點型、布爾型、字符型。 整數型:byte、short、int、long 浮點型:float、double 布爾 ...